Weeding and mulching services involve removing unwanted plants and applying mulch to garden beds, pathways, and landscaped areas. The process typically includes identifying and eliminating weeds that compete with desirable plants for nutrients and water, as well as spreading mulch to help suppress future weed growth. These services can be tailored to suit the specific needs of a property, whether it’s a small residential yard or a larger landscaped estate. The goal is to create a tidy, healthy outdoor space that requires less maintenance over time.

This service helps address common landscaping problems such as persistent weed growth, soil erosion, and uneven garden beds. Weeds can quickly take over if not managed properly, making it difficult to maintain a neat appearance or grow desired plants. Mulching provides a protective layer over soil, helping to retain moisture, regulate temperature, and reduce weed germination. Regular weeding and mulching can also improve the overall health of a landscape by promoting better soil conditions and reducing the need for chemical weed control.

The overview below groups typical Weeding And Mulching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Jobs - Typical costs for routine weeding and mulching projects range from $250 to $600. Many homeowners find this covers basic garden beds or small yard areas. Prices can vary based on the size and complexity of the work.

Medium Projects - For larger landscapes or multiple beds, costs generally fall between $600 and $1,500. Many local contractors handle these projects regularly within this range, though larger or more detailed jobs may cost more.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ive weeding and mulching, such as large commercial properties or extensive landscaping, can range from $1,500 to $3,500 or higher. These projects are less common and typically involve significant area or specialized requirements.

Full Replacement or Major Overhaul - Complete garden makeovers or multi-acre sites may re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and often involve detailed planning and execution by experienced service providers, with costs varying based on scope and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of weed control services? Weed control services help prevent unwanted plants from taking over garden beds and lawns, promoting healthier growth for desired plants.

How does mulching improve garden health? Mulching helps ret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, and regulate soil temperature, creating a better environment for plants to thrive.

Can weed and mulch services be customized for different landscapes? Yes, local contractors often tailor weed and mulching solutions to suit various garden sizes, types, and aesthetic preferences.

What types of mulch are available through professional services? Service providers typically offer a range of mulch options, including bark, wood chips, straw, and rubber mulch, to meet different needs.
